AMD FirePro W9000 vs NVIDIA GeForce GTX 460 OEM
AMD FirePro W9000 vs NVIDIA GeForce GTX 460 OEM
VS
AMD FirePro W9000
NVIDIA GeForce GTX 460 OEM
We compared two Desktop platform GPUs: 6GB VRAM FirePro W9000 and 1024MB VRAM GeForce GTX 460 OEM to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.
Main Differences
AMD FirePro W9000 's Advantages
Released 1 years and 8 months late
More VRAM (6GB vs 1GB)
Larger VRAM bandwidth (264.0GB/s vs 108.8GB/s)
1712 additional rendering cores
NVIDIA GeForce GTX 460 OEM 's Advantages
Lower TDP (150W vs 274W)
